Individuals may be homozygous for these SNPs affecting methylation, this means both of those copies on the gene are impacted, or they may be heterozygous and also have a single SNP and just one conventional copy of the gene. getting a homozygous profile can lessen methylation of folate to five-tetramethylhydrofolate (five-MTHF) by up to seventy five%, rendering it demanding to the influenced personal to efficiently operate basic metabolic procedures that depend on methylation, which includes homocysteine regulation, neurotransmitter and temper regulation, and basic DNA repair service.

Taking advantage of these new assays to interrogate DNA methylation marks throughout the genome, research are actually performed comparing men and women with SLE to healthful people today. These EWAS are modelled following genome-wide association research and test whether the standard of DNA methylation at specific cytosines in the genome differs amid folks with SLE when compared with healthy controls. it truly is inferred that differential methylation of CpG websites possible influences the expression of close by genes, and thus differential methylation identifies precise genes which could affect SLE hazard or the development of particular ailment manifestations.

The substitution lowers the affinity of MTHFR and its cofactor, which encourages the thermolability and diminishes the enzyme activity. Comparing with wild genotype (CC), the heterozygote (CT) and mutation homozygote (TT) bring on the decrease of enzyme activity by about 34 and seventy five%, and increased thermolability in lymphocyte extracts25. In 2001, the Ala222Val mutation was made in human MTHFR, plus the mutant protein was productively purified and its Qualities ended up identified. various from the previous research, the Ala222Val variant exhibits equivalent catalytic properties given that the wild-kind enzyme, however it is thermolabile17.

DNA methylation takes place every time a methyl team is additional to the fifth carbon of cytosine residues which can be linked by a phosphate to your guanine nucleotide (a CpG dinucleotide) by DNA methyltransferases (DNMT1, DNMT3A and DNMT3B). This addition varieties 5-methylcytosine (figure one).11 The methyl team is received from your methyl donor S adenosine methionine (SAM).
